PROBLEM SET 5, QUESTION 7:

The reaction is:

73Li + 147N --> X + 178O.

In any reaction (except beta decay) the total number of protons is the same before and after the reaction. Also the total number of neutrons is the same before and after. It follows that the total of the mass numbers before the reaction is the same as after the reaction. Therefore, we can figure out the proton number and the mass number of X.

The total proton number on the left is 3 + 7 = 10. The proton number of the oxygen on the right is 8, so the proton number of X must 10 - 8 = 2. The total mass number on the left is 21, so the mass number of X must be 21 - 17 = 4. The element with atomic number 2 is helium. So X must be 42He.
